Output 3aeb3c75824c2294a20e5ad877c36eefd3e84ed8e1a8000f420d83b06604ccab:0

value
2766364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9917e0111720105d897d8c50fcae112642dca199 OP_EQUAL
address
3FeVumxkKyyZRZdkkNYUZDCVEwxbbdrTUF
transaction
3aeb3c75824c2294a20e5ad877c36eefd3e84ed8e1a8000f420d83b06604ccab